Ziwa Rhino Sanctuary offers travelers more than just thrilling rhino tracking it also provides a range of accommodation options to suit every budget and style. Nestled in Nakasongola District, the sanctuary is Uganda’s only home for wild rhinos, making it a must‑visit stop on safari itineraries. Staying within or near the sanctuary allows guests to immerse themselves in conservation while enjoying comfort, adventure, or simplicity depending on their choice. From the exclusive Amuka Safari Lodge with rustic chalets and modern amenities, to budget guesthouses and adventurous camping experiences, Ziwa caters to diverse travelers. Each option offers unique advantages, whether it’s waking up to rhinos grazing nearby, sharing stories by a bonfire, or enjoying tranquil farm stays. Accommodation enhances the sanctuary’s unforgettable wildlife encounters.


1. Amuka Safari Lodge
As the only lodge located inside the sanctuary, Amuka offers the most exclusive and immersive experience . It features 10 beautifully crafted chalets six standard and four family units built from reclaimed mahogany and stone, giving them a rustic yet elegant feel . Each chalet is named after a resident rhino and includes a private veranda for wildlife viewing . The lodge offers modern comforts like a swimming pool, a restaurant serving delicious local and international cuisine, and a bar . Guests consistently praise the friendly staff, comfortable rooms, and the incredible experience of waking up to rhinos grazing nearby . Rates for standard chalets generally start from $150-$200 per night .


2. Ziwa Rhino Sanctuary Guesthouse
For travelers on a tighter budget, the sanctuary's on-site guesthouse provides a clean, no-frills option just near the main entrance . It features simple rooms with private bathrooms and solar-powered lighting . Guests have access to shared lounges and the on-site restaurant, and staff are known for their friendliness, often sharing stories around evening bonfires . It’s a very practical and affordable choice, with rates typically between $20 and $50 per person per night . This option is ideal for backpackers and those looking to rest before continuing their journey.


3. Camping at Ziwa Rhino Sanctuary
For the ultimate adventure and connection with nature, you can pitch your own tent in a designated, secure area within the sanctuary . This is a fully immersive experience, with 24/7 ranger security and shared facilities including hot showers and cooking areas . You’ll be surrounded by the sounds of the African bush, from birdsong at dawn to the calls of wildlife at night. The sanctuary can provide firewood for a bush braai (barbecue). This is a great choice for eco-enthusiasts and adventurers seeking the most authentic and budget-friendly experience.


4. Butiti Ranch Stay
Located about a 55-minute drive from Ziwa, this is an off-site alternative offering a different kind of stay . It is an entire home with two bedrooms that can sleep up to six guests, making it a good option for a small group or family seeking self-catering accommodation . It features amenities like free parking, a terrace, and a garden. However, its distance from the sanctuary means you would lose the convenience of being on-site for the early morning rhino tracking activities, making it less ideal for visitors whose primary purpose is visiting Ziwa.

6. Ziwa Sanctuary Camping
For the ultimate nature immersion, the sanctuary offers a secure campground with excellent facilities . The campsite features a good ablution block with hot showers, a covered dining area, and a central fire pit lit at night for a communal atmosphere . A unique highlight is the "rhino parade," where rhinos often promenade around the strong perimeter fence in the early evening or morning, offering incredible, close-up views from your tent . This is the perfect budget-friendly and adventurous option for those wanting to connect deeply with the wilderness.
